Create a value of TopBottomMoversComputation with all optional fields omitted.
Use generic-lens or optics to modify other optional fields.
The following record fields are available, with the corresponding lenses provided for backwards compatibility:
$sel:moverSize:TopBottomMoversComputation', topBottomMoversComputation_moverSize - The mover size setup of the top and bottom movers computation.
$sel:name:TopBottomMoversComputation', topBottomMoversComputation_name - The name of a computation.
$sel:sortOrder:TopBottomMoversComputation', topBottomMoversComputation_sortOrder - The sort order setup of the top and bottom movers computation.
$sel:value:TopBottomMoversComputation', topBottomMoversComputation_value - The value field that is used in a computation.
$sel:computationId:TopBottomMoversComputation', topBottomMoversComputation_computationId - The ID for a computation.
$sel:time:TopBottomMoversComputation', topBottomMoversComputation_time - The time field that is used in a computation.
$sel:category:TopBottomMoversComputation', topBottomMoversComputation_category - The category field that is used in a computation.
$sel:type':TopBottomMoversComputation', topBottomMoversComputation_type - The computation type. Choose from the following options:
- TOP: Top movers computation.
- BOTTOM: Bottom movers computation.
